The Center for Innovative Pedagogy will host a discussion for faculty about "Skim, Dive, Surface: Teaching Digital Reading" by Jenae Cohn on July 14 and 28.

Lunch will be provided.

In higher education, teachers rarely consider how digital reading experiences may have an impact on learning abilities, unless they’re lamenting students’ attention spans or the distractions available to students when they’re learning online. "Skim, Dive, Surface" offers a corrective to these conversations — an invitation to focus not on losses to student learning but on the spectrum of affordances available within digital learning environments.
